/linux/arch/arm64/kernel/ |
A D | cpuidle.c | 54 struct acpi_lpi_state *lpi; in psci_acpi_cpu_init_idle() local 74 lpi = &pr->power.lpi_states[i + 1]; in psci_acpi_cpu_init_idle() 79 state = lpi->address; in psci_acpi_cpu_init_idle() 94 int acpi_processor_ffh_lpi_enter(struct acpi_lpi_state *lpi) in acpi_processor_ffh_lpi_enter() argument 96 u32 state = lpi->address; in acpi_processor_ffh_lpi_enter() 98 if (ARM64_LPI_IS_RETENTION_STATE(lpi->arch_flags)) in acpi_processor_ffh_lpi_enter() 100 lpi->index, state); in acpi_processor_ffh_lpi_enter() 103 lpi->index, state); in acpi_processor_ffh_lpi_enter()
|
/linux/drivers/acpi/ |
A D | processor_idle.c | 1143 int __weak acpi_processor_ffh_lpi_enter(struct acpi_lpi_state *lpi) in acpi_processor_ffh_lpi_enter() argument 1160 struct acpi_lpi_state *lpi; in acpi_idle_lpi_enter() local 1167 lpi = &pr->power.lpi_states[index]; in acpi_idle_lpi_enter() 1168 if (lpi->entry_method == ACPI_CSTATE_FFH) in acpi_idle_lpi_enter() 1169 return acpi_processor_ffh_lpi_enter(lpi); in acpi_idle_lpi_enter() 1177 struct acpi_lpi_state *lpi; in acpi_processor_setup_lpi_states() local 1185 lpi = &pr->power.lpi_states[i]; in acpi_processor_setup_lpi_states() 1189 strlcpy(state->desc, lpi->desc, CPUIDLE_DESC_LEN); in acpi_processor_setup_lpi_states() 1190 state->exit_latency = lpi->wake_latency; in acpi_processor_setup_lpi_states() 1191 state->target_residency = lpi->min_residency; in acpi_processor_setup_lpi_states() [all …]
|
/linux/Documentation/devicetree/bindings/pinctrl/ |
A D | qcom,lpass-lpi-pinctrl.yaml | 4 $id: http://devicetree.org/schemas/pinctrl/qcom,lpass-lpi-pinctrl.yaml# 19 const: qcom,sm8250-lpass-lpi-pinctrl 121 compatible = "qcom,sm8250-lpass-lpi-pinctrl";
|
/linux/Documentation/devicetree/bindings/net/ |
A D | samsung-sxgbe.txt | 8 trasmit DMA interrupts, receive DMA interrupts and lpi interrupt. 12 and 1 optional lpi interrupt.
|
A D | snps,dwc-qos-ethernet.txt | 108 - snps,en-lpi: If present it enables use of the AXI low-power interface 117 - snps,en-tx-lpi-clockgating: Enable gating of the MAC TX clock during 149 snps,en-tx-lpi-clockgating; 150 snps,en-lpi;
|
A D | snps,dwmac.yaml | 264 snps,en-tx-lpi-clockgating:
|
/linux/drivers/media/pci/cx88/ |
A D | cx88-core.c | 73 unsigned int lines, unsigned int lpi, bool jump) in cx88_risc_field() argument 94 if (lpi && line > 0 && !(line % lpi)) in cx88_risc_field() 179 unsigned int lines, unsigned int lpi) in cx88_risc_databuffer() argument 202 lines, lpi, !lpi); in cx88_risc_databuffer()
|
A D | cx88.h | 629 unsigned int lines, unsigned int lpi);
|
/linux/drivers/media/pci/cx25821/ |
A D | cx25821-core.c | 1109 unsigned int lines, unsigned int lpi) in cx25821_risc_field_audio() argument 1126 if (lpi && line > 0 && !(line % lpi)) in cx25821_risc_field_audio() 1171 unsigned int lines, unsigned int lpi) in cx25821_risc_databuffer_audio() argument 1192 lines, lpi); in cx25821_risc_databuffer_audio()
|
A D | cx25821.h | 407 unsigned int lines, unsigned int lpi);
|
/linux/drivers/pinctrl/qcom/ |
A D | Makefile | 41 obj-$(CONFIG_PINCTRL_LPASS_LPI) += pinctrl-lpass-lpi.o
|
/linux/drivers/media/common/saa7146/ |
A D | saa7146_hlp.c | 216 int lpi = 0; in calculate_v_scale_registers() local 237 lpi = 1; in calculate_v_scale_registers() 243 lpi = 1; in calculate_v_scale_registers() 247 if( 0 != lpi ) { in calculate_v_scale_registers()
|
/linux/drivers/net/ethernet/stmicro/stmmac/ |
A D | dwxgmac2_core.c | 260 u32 lpi = readl(ioaddr + XGMAC_LPI_CTRL); in dwxgmac2_host_irq_status() local 262 if (lpi & XGMAC_TLPIEN) { in dwxgmac2_host_irq_status() 266 if (lpi & XGMAC_TLPIEX) { in dwxgmac2_host_irq_status() 270 if (lpi & XGMAC_RLPIEN) in dwxgmac2_host_irq_status() 272 if (lpi & XGMAC_RLPIEX) in dwxgmac2_host_irq_status()
|
/linux/drivers/media/pci/cx23885/ |
A D | cx23885-core.c | 1134 unsigned int lines, unsigned int lpi, bool jump) in cx23885_risc_field() argument 1158 if (lpi && line > 0 && !(line % lpi)) in cx23885_risc_field() 1245 unsigned int lines, unsigned int lpi) in cx23885_risc_databuffer() argument 1267 bpl, 0, lines, lpi, lpi == 0); in cx23885_risc_databuffer()
|
A D | cx23885.h | 626 unsigned int lpi);
|
/linux/Documentation/networking/ |
A D | ethtool-netlink.rst | 1094 ``ETHTOOL_A_EEE_TX_LPI_ENABLED`` bool Tx lpi enabled 1095 ``ETHTOOL_A_EEE_TX_LPI_TIMER`` u32 Tx lpi timeout (in us) 1116 ``ETHTOOL_A_EEE_TX_LPI_ENABLED`` bool Tx lpi enabled 1117 ``ETHTOOL_A_EEE_TX_LPI_TIMER`` u32 Tx lpi timeout (in us)
|
/linux/arch/arm/boot/dts/ |
A D | stm32mp151.dtsi | 1449 snps,en-tx-lpi-clockgating;
|
/linux/arch/arm64/boot/dts/qcom/ |
A D | sm8250.dtsi | 1845 compatible = "qcom,sm8250-lpass-lpi-pinctrl";
|